Piston, Pin, and Connecting Rod Installation

    Lubricate the following components with clean engine oil:

    • Piston
    • Piston rings
    • Cylinder bore
    • Bearings and bearing surfaces
  2. Install the bearings to the connecting rod and cap.
  3. Position the oil control ring end gaps a minimum of 25 mm (1.0 in) from each other.
  4. Position the compression ring end gaps 180 degrees opposite each other.

    Install the EN - 41556  rod guide to the connecting rod.

    Identify the proper installation direction of the piston and connecting rod assembly. The right and left side are assembled differently. Right Side: The arrow on top of the piston and the dimple (2) on the rod face the same direction. When installing the right side piston and rod (3) assemblies, the arrow on top of the piston and the dimple (2) on the rod face the front of the engine. the raised bump (4) on the bottom of the rod (3) will be closest to the outside of the engine. The deepest part of the fuel bowl (1) must face the outside of the engine.

    Left Side: the arrow on top of the piston and the dimple on the rod face the opposite direction. When installing the left side piston and rod (2) assemblies, the arrow on top of the piston faces the front of the engine and the dimple on the rod faces the rear of the engine. The raised bump (3) on the bottom of rod will be closest to the outside of engine. The deepest part of the fuel bowl (1) must face the outside of the engine.

  8. NOTE:

    When installing a piston into a cylinder, use a ring compressor sleeve or equivalent for best results. The following features should be looked for when selecting a ring compressor sleeve.

    • Hard anodized and Teflon coated for low friction and prolonged wear resistance.
    • Smooth radius that tapers down to the specific bore size.
    • Sleeve should compress the piston rings smoothly and evenly.
    • Using a ring compressor sleeve greatly reduces the difficulty with installing thin high-performance oil rings.

    If a ring compressor sleeve is unavailable, a universal ring compressor will work, but is more difficult to use.

  9. Compress the piston rings using a ring compressor sleeve or equivalent.

    NOTE:

    The arrow on the top of the piston MUST face the front of the engine block. The deepest portion of the fuel bowls (1) must be toward the outside of the engine.

    Install the piston, pin, and connecting rod assembly into the cylinder bore. Tap the piston into the bore with a wooden hammer handle. Guide the connecting rod to the crankshaft journal using the J-41556  rod guide while gently tapping the piston into place. Hold the ring compressor sleeve or equivalent against the engine block until all rings have entered the cylinder bore.

  11. Remove the EN - 41556  rod guide from the connecting rod.

    CAUTION:

    This vehicle is equipped with torque-to-yield or single use fasteners. Install a NEW torque-to-yield or single use fastener when installing this component. Failure to replace the torque-to-yield or single use fastener could cause damage to the vehicle or component.

    CAUTION:

    Refer to Fastener Caution .

    NOTE:
    • The connecting rod and cap must be assembled with the mating surfaces properly aligned.
    • If re-using connecting rods, DO NOT re-use connecting rod fasteners. During an installation procedure, the new connecting rod bolts can be re-tightened a maximum of 3 times.

    Install the bearing (1), bearing cap (2), and bolts (3).

    1. Tighten the bolts a first pass to 20 N.m (15 lb ft).
    2. Tighten the bolts a final pass to 85 degrees using the EN - 45059  angle meter.

    Measure the connecting rods for the proper side clearance. Refer to Engine Mechanical Specifications (LV1) .
